When you are happy and you know it hop around UK ADORABLE IMAGES of the cutest roe deer skipping away on a farm in the Cotswolds, Gloucestershire, were captured on January 28. The images show the young adult roe deer leaping while sticking its tongue out as if in celebration. Just like the red deer, the roe deer is the UK’s native deer species. By the 19th century, roe deer had disappeared from most of the UK, surviving only in Scotland and isolated pockets elsewhere. Reintroductions from Europe and positive habitat change helped the species recover, and it is now abundant. These lovely images were snapped by British wildlife photographer Talvinder Chohan (41) with a Canon EOS R5 camera and a 400mm lens. “This was such a surreal experience. I initially noticed this deer hopping about 230 feet away from me and started snapping its pictures,” he said. “But then it kept running in my direction, and I was shocked because this is a very shy deer species, so I assumed it hadn’t noticed me. “It was amazing watching him run directly towards me with his tongue hanging out and this goofy expression. “It was such a unique experience, so I just stood there and kept snapping its pictures. “Eventually, he spotted me and stopped, looked at me for a bit and then ran off in another direction. I came across him by chance, but I am so glad I did.” ENDs
